Many of us have started college classes or will be in the next few weeks.

It's a bittersweet feeling because summer is ending, but you are ready to have another year of college under your belt. Syllabus week is probably the best week of college because it's an easy way to get acclimated to your professors, classmates, and determine how your course load will be for the rest of the semester.

If this isn't your first year of college, you already know the drill and can relate to these scenarios that Barney Stinson illustrates.

If this is your first year, this is a good guide to what to expect on your first week of college.
